First Custodian Fund India Ltd has informed BSE that it has availed an exemption under Regulation 15(2) of SEBI (LODR) Regulations, 2015 for FY 2026-27. This exemption absolves the company from filing half-yearly Related Party Transaction disclosures under Regulation 23(9), which normally requires companies to disclose related party transactions every six months within 15 days of publishing financial results. The company filed the exemption letter along with a certificate from Practicing Company Secretaries M/s. P. C. Shah & Co., confirming its paid-up share capital and net worth as of 31st March 2026. The board approved this decision at its meeting on 29th May 2026. The exemption is available to smaller listed companies meeting certain thresholds on paid-up capital and net worth.
This exemption reduces compliance burden for the company but provides less transparency to shareholders on related party dealings. It is a routine procedural filing for qualifying smaller listed companies and is not expected to have a direct impact on the stock price.
